FBI background checks (Identity History Summaries) are issued by a
federal agency, not a state government. Therefore, they must be
apostilled by the
U.S. Department of State in Washington, D.C.,
rather than by state Secretary of State offices. This federal
apostille certifies the authenticity of the FBI seal and signature
for international use in all Hague Convention member countries.

Yes! China acceded to the Hague Convention on March
8, 2023, and it entered into force on November 7, 2023. Documents
destined for mainland China — including FBI background checks,
diplomas, birth certificates, and marriage licenses — can now be
authenticated with a standard apostille instead of
the multi-step consular legalization process previously required.
Your FBI background check must have the
official FBI seal (a raised embossed seal visible
on the document) for the U.S. Department of State to accept it for
apostille. Digital watermarks alone are not sufficient. When you
request your Identity History Summary, make sure to select the
option that includes the official embossed seal.

FBI Background Check Apostilles are recognized in all
120+ countries that are members of the Hague
Apostille Convention — including recently added China (2023).
Popular destinations include Spain, Italy, France, Germany, United
Kingdom, Australia, Mexico, Canada, Japan, South Korea, and many
more. For non-member countries like Russia, UAE, or Saudi Arabia,
embassy legalization is required instead.
